GEMS Jumeira Primary School occupies a purpose-built, two-floor campus in the prestigious Al Safa / Jumeirah district of Dubai, established in 1996 and continuously developed since. The school is organised thoughtfully to manage its 1,466-student roll without the sense of scale that number might suggest: the Foundation Stage occupies its own dedicated block with separated outdoor play areas, Years 1 and 2 sit to the rear on the ground floor, and Years 3 to 6 occupy separate corridors upstairs. Different age groups rarely cross paths, and playgrounds are carefully divided — a deliberate design choice that creates a community feel despite the school's size. Campus size data is not publicly disclosed, which is a gap for parents comparing physical footprints across schools.

Sports provision is a genuine strength. JPS offers a partly shaded 25-metre swimming pool alongside a dedicated infant learning pool — a meaningful differentiator for early years families. A large, temperature-controlled gymnasium with professional gymnastics equipment, a multi-purpose sports hall, an all-weather synthetic turf (3G Astroturf) pitch, and tennis and netball courts round out a sports offering that comfortably meets expectations at this fee level. The temperature-controlled gym is a practical consideration in Dubai's climate that not all schools at this price point provide.

Technology infrastructure is well-developed. Classrooms are fitted with Apple TV, green screens are deployed throughout the school, and iPads and laptops are available across all year groups. The purpose-built STEAM Studio supports computational thinking and engineering, while the Learning Lounge — equipped with Apple technology — is notably open to parents, pupils, and staff alike, reflecting the school's community-oriented ethos. A dedicated FS Computer Suite, MAC zones, an Arabic Reading Room, and an ELL Teaching Room further demonstrate investment in specialist learning spaces.

Medical provision stands out: the on-site clinic is staffed by two Dubai Health Authority-registered nurses and a full-time doctor — a level of medical resourcing that exceeds what many comparable schools offer. The school also provides individual and group music rooms, a library, a prayer room, and four school playgrounds. KHDA inspectors specifically cited "the stimulating and cohesive learning environment" as a highlight in the 2023–2024 inspection, and management, staffing, facilities and resources were rated Outstanding — the top grade. At fees ranging from AED 44,200 to AED 55,714, JPS sits just above the median for British curriculum schools in Dubai (median: AED 49,630), and the facilities broadly reflect that positioning. The sports infrastructure, dual pools, Apple-integrated technology ecosystem, and full medical team represent solid value at this tier. Parents considering schools at the upper end of the British curriculum fee range — where fees can reach AED 90,000 or more — will find meaningfully more expansive campuses and dedicated performing arts theatres elsewhere; but for its actual fee band, JPS delivers a well-resourced, thoughtfully organised environment that the inspection record consistently validates.
